This app represents the next stage in traditional password keeping apps and acts as a payment authenticator for personal bank accounts and online merchants.
The app provides three-layered authentication that can be used for bank transactions, cloud-based databases, online gaming, electronic health records, and cashless store purchases.
With encrypted communication, the mobile app allows users to protect themselves against identity theft, phishing, skimming and credit card hijacking.
Thanks to the authentication-as-a-service system, it is possible to authorise transactions even when using an unsecured network.
Applied technologies:
- Swift
- Java
- AngularJS
- PostgreSQL